Nags Head, United States of America

No dates selected

Sort by

Price per night in

Distance from the city center

Hotels with parking in Nags Head

: 96 options found

Select dates so you can see the availability and exact prices.

8645 Old Oregon Inlet Road, Nags Head
8.3 km from the center of Nags Head
72 reviews
7.4

Room in this hotel

from $ 129
per night
4905 South Virginia Dare Trail, Nags Head, NC 27959, United States of America, Nags Head
2.1 km from the center of Nags Head

Room in this hotel

from $ 165
per night
303 E Admiral Street, Nags Head
3.4 km from the center of Nags Head
130 reviews
9.4

Room in this hotel

from $ 119
per night
6401 South Virginia Dare Trail, Nags Head
4.3 km from the center of Nags Head
41 reviews
6.0

Room in this hotel

from $ 131
per night
4701 S Virginia Dare Trl, Nags Head
1.5 km from the center of Nags Head
693 reviews
8.4

Room in this hotel

from $ 165
per night
5305 Sand Wedge Lane, Nags Head, NC 27959, United States of America, Nags Head
2.6 km from the center of Nags Head

Room in this hotel

from $ 2,629
per night
1701 S Virginia Dare Trl, Kill Devil Hills
5.1 km from the center of Nags Head
3424 reviews
7.6

Room in this hotel

from $ 116
per night
7218 S Virginia Dare Trail, Nags Head
5.8 km from the center of Nags Head
215 reviews
7.2

Room in this hotel

from $ 96
per night
6715 South Croatan Hwy, Nags Head
4.7 km from the center of Nags Head
448 reviews
9.0

Room in this hotel

from $ 272
per night
1509 S. Virginia Dare Trail, Kill Devil Hills
5.3 km from the center of Nags Head
178 reviews
8.0

Room in this hotel

from $ 148
per night
7740 S. Virginia Dare Trail, Nags Head
6.7 km from the center of Nags Head
84 reviews
6.0

Room in this hotel

from $ 118
per night
2009 S Virginia Dare Trl, Kill Devil Hills
4.8 km from the center of Nags Head
316 reviews
9.0

Room in this hotel

from $ 111
per night
8017 Old Oregon Inlet Rd., Nags Head
6.2 km from the center of Nags Head
128 reviews
7.0

Room in this hotel

from $ 122
per night
3329 S Virginia Dare Trl, Nags Head
2.1 km from the center of Nags Head
378 reviews
7.0

Room in this hotel

from $ 123
per night
8031 S Old Oregon Inlet Rd, Nags Head
6.2 km from the center of Nags Head
868 reviews
8.0

Room in this hotel

from $ 149
per night
1601 Virginia Dare Trail, Kill Devil Hills
5.2 km from the center of Nags Head
704 reviews
7.0

Room in this hotel

from $ 124
per night
6701 Virginia Dare Trail, Nags Head
4.6 km from the center of Nags Head
3158 reviews
9.2

Room in this hotel

from $ 129
per night
7010 S. Virginia Dare Trail, Nags Head
5.2 km from the center of Nags Head
37 reviews
8.0

Room in this hotel

from $ 126
per night
Kill Devil Hills North Carolina, Kill Devil Hills
5.5 km from the center of Nags Head

Room in this hotel

from $ 175
per night
8201 South Old Oregon Inlet Road, Nags Head, NC 27959, United States of America, Nags Head
6.6 km from the center of Nags Head

Room in this hotel

from $ 646
per night